So instead of that rant - LOL - I have made something with purple in it:


I cut two pieces of purple card with this square scallopped hole Spellbinder die and put them to one side. Then I cut another two pieces of square purple card 14 cm x 14 cm. I scored both squares on the Crafters Companion box maker using the 1 inch groove. That means the box when assembled is roughly 9 cm x 9 cm and fits neatly into the die cuts. 

The box is decorated with a Lili of the Valley die cut image mounted with foam pads. The corners are decorated with a few gems, perls, ribbon and charm from my stash.
